Czech Republic overlooks human rights abuses by Chinese Govt. for business interests, according to Slovak press

"Slovak press: Czechs overlook human rights for business interests"

The Czech Republic turns a blind eye to human rights being abused by the Chinese communist regime for the sake of business, Slovak daily Sme writes on a visit by Chinese President Xi Jinping to the Czech Republic...Daily Pravda...mentions the CEFC group's investments in the Czech Republic and its effort to gain a 50 percent stake in the J&T and Penta financial groups that own big assets not only in the Czech Republic, but also in Slovakia.
